Common problems with sexual intercourse during pregnancy: Sexual intercourse is prohibited during the first three months and the last two months of pregnancy. In the early stages of pregnancy, the embryo is in a rapid development process, and the connection between the fetus and the mother is not yet very strong. External stimuli such as sexual intercourse can easily induce uterine contractions and cause miscarriage. In the second and third trimesters of pregnancy, especially after 36 weeks of pregnancy, signs of labor may appear at any time. During intercourse, the stimulation of the male penis on the cervix and the prostaglandins in the semen cause uterine contractions, which can easily lead to premature birth, abnormal uterine bleeding or infection. You can have intercourse in the remaining months of pregnancy, but the frequency and intensity of intercourse must be controlled, and you should do some daily hygiene before intercourse to avoid intrauterine infection caused by intercourse and harm to the health of the mother and fetus. The intercourse posture should be with the woman on top and the lateral position preferably to avoid direct stimulation of the uterus.
